Redesign a healthcare provider portal by starting with the work providers and staff perform most often, not with the existing screen structure. Map the highest-value workflows, identify where information is hard to find or actions are difficult to complete, then redesign a representative set of tasks that establishes the new hierarchy, interaction patterns, and design system. Once those patterns are proven, they can be propagated across the rest of the portal.

Provider Portals Are Workflow Systems, Not Collections of Pages
A provider portal may support patient review, referrals, documentation, authorizations, messages, scheduling, claims, reporting, service creation, and administrative tasks. Those activities connect to one another, which means the redesign should begin with workflow relationships rather than isolated screens.
Simply making each page look cleaner can leave the same underlying friction intact. The more important question is how people move through the work: what information they need first, what decisions they make next, what they must remember, where they lose context, and which actions repeatedly slow them down.
Start With High-Frequency and High-Friction Tasks
Not every area of a large healthcare portal deserves equal attention at the beginning. Identify the tasks providers and staff perform constantly, the tasks that generate support questions, and the tasks where mistakes, delays, or unclear status have the greatest consequence.
Those workflows are strong candidates for the initial prototype because they expose the information hierarchy, forms, tables, statuses, navigation, and interaction patterns the rest of the portal will need. A representative slice of the product can establish the redesign language before hundreds of screens are propagated.
Design Provider Interfaces for Scanning, Not Reading
Provider-facing software often contains a great deal of information. Users should not have to read every line to understand what requires attention. Strong grouping, typography, status treatment, labels, spacing, and visual hierarchy can make dense information significantly easier to scan.
This is especially important for queues, patient lists, task panels, reports, and dashboards where users repeatedly compare multiple items. Density is not automatically bad UX. Unstructured density is. The goal is to help experienced users absorb more information without forcing them to work harder to interpret it.
Create Reusable Patterns Across the Entire Portal
Large portals frequently show signs of incremental growth. One module uses a drawer, another uses a modal, another opens a new page. Forms validate differently. Status colors drift. Buttons move from screen to screen. Over time, the product begins to feel like several applications stitched together.
A redesign should establish reusable interaction and visual patterns so the portal behaves like one product. A strong design system can reduce learning burden, support future modules, and give the development team a consistent foundation as the application continues to grow.

Our second InnovaMD healthcare portal engagement began with two weeks of user research and interviews before the interface was redesigned. Physicians, clinic administrators, and office staff helped identify the usability, workflow, navigation, and interaction problems that actually needed to be solved. The redesign then addressed complex provider-facing workflows, including dashboard information, patient and beneficiary data, reports, analytics, services, documents, medication reconciliation, and multi-step processes. Should Every Provider Portal Screen Be Redesigned at Once?
No. A representative set of high-value workflows can establish the direction before the design is propagated across the entire portal. That first set should be chosen carefully because it needs to expose the major layout, navigation, form, table, status, modal, drawer, and responsive patterns the rest of the application will eventually use.
This approach also gives the product team an opportunity to validate the new structure before investing in full propagation. If the portal is very large, the redesign can then move through modules in a logical sequence instead of forcing the organization to treat every screen as an equally urgent problem.
How Important Are Tables in Provider Portal UX?
Very. Many provider workflows depend on scanning lists, comparing records, filtering, sorting, reviewing status, and acting on individual rows. A poorly designed table can turn routine work into constant horizontal scanning, repeated clicks, and unnecessary context switching.
Table design should consider persistent context, column priority, filters, selection behavior, bulk actions, responsive strategy, row-level actions, expandable details, empty states, and the difference between information users need constantly versus information they need only occasionally. In provider software, a table is often the workflow, not just a way of displaying data.
Can a Provider Portal Be Modernized Without Changing the Backend?
Often, yes. The interface can sometimes be redesigned around existing services, data structures, and business logic, depending on the technical constraints. A front-end redesign can improve hierarchy, navigation, task flow, forms, tables, responsive behavior, status communication, and visual consistency without requiring the entire product architecture to be replaced.
The limits become clear during discovery. If the current backend prevents the new workflow from behaving correctly, the design team and development team need to identify that early. The goal is not to force a visual concept onto the existing system. It is to find the strongest experience the technical reality can support and clearly identify where deeper changes would create meaningful value.
